#bbf392 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bbf392 is composed of 73.3% red, 95.3%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23% cyan, 0% magenta, 39.9%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 94.6 degrees, a saturation of 80.2% and a lightness of 76.3%. #bbf392 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#77e725. Closest websafe color is: #ccff99.

#bbf392 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#bbf392 has RGB values of R:187, G:243, B:146 and CMYK values of C:0.23, M:0, Y:0.4,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 12317586.

Hex triplet bbf392 #bbf392
RGB Decimal 187, 243, 146 rgb(187,243,146)
RGB Percent 73.3, 95.3, 57.3 rgb(73.3%,95.3%,57.3%)
CMYK 23, 0, 40, 5
HSL 94.6°, 80.2, 76.3 hsl(94.6,80.2%,76.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 94.6°, 39.9, 95.3
Web Safe ccff99 #ccff99
CIE-LAB 90.202, -34.325, 41.115
XYZ 57.731, 76.74, 38.963
xyY 0.333, 0.442, 76.74
CIE-LCH 90.202, 53.56, 129.857
CIE-LUV 90.202, -27.736, 61.719
Hunter-Lab 87.601, -35.668, 34.95
Binary 10111011, 11110011, 10010010

Shades and Tints of #bbf392

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070f02 is the darkest color, while #fdfffc is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#bbf392 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#d7d7d7 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#d1ddc9 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#f8e492 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#ffdebf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#cfe7f8 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#e2e992 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#e6e6af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#c8ebd3 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
